DEC Urges Caution When Outdoor Burning

The state Department of Environmental Conservation urges New Yorkers to exercise extra caution before any outdoor burning. The Adirondack Daily Enterprise reports current warm and dry conditions are causing an increased fire risk across the state. DEC encourages people to put safety first, not leave fires unattended and ensure all fires are fully extinguished. Much of New York is abnormally dry and fire risk is either high or moderate for the entire state.
